74-7018. Applications for license; fee; time. Applications for licensure shall be submitted on forms prescribed by the board and shall contain information concerning the applicant's education and a detailed summary of the applicant's technical work, previous examinations, if any, and the results thereof and such other information and references as may be required by the board. All such applications shall be submitted to the executive director, together with the application fee prescribed under K.S.A. 74-7009, and amendments thereto, within a time period to be determined by the board.

History: L. 1978, ch. 326, § 14; L. 1992, ch. 240, § 11; L. 2009, ch. 94, § 4; July 1.
